What does a construction foreman do?

A Construction Foreman is responsible for supervising and coordinating the activities of workers on a construction site. They ensure that projects are completed on time, within budget, and according to safety and quality standards. Foremen assign tasks, monitor progress, solve problems that arise on-site, and act as a liaison between workers, subcontractors, and management. They also ensure that all safety protocols are followed and may be involved in training new workers.

What are some common challenges a construction foreman faces when managing a diverse crew on a job site?

A Construction Foreman often encounters challenges such as coordinating team members with varying skill levels, ensuring clear communication across language or cultural barriers, and resolving conflicts that arise during high-pressure situations. Maintaining productivity while upholding safety standards is crucial, especially when managing multiple subcontractors or trades simultaneously. Successful foremen use strong leadership and organizational skills to foster teamwork, provide on-the-job training, and adapt to changing project demands.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a construction foreman,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Construction Foreman, you need strong knowledge of construction processes, blueprint reading, safety protocols, and often a background in construction management or a related trade. Familiarity with project management software, scheduling tools, and OSHA certifications is typically required. Leadership, problem-solving, and effective communication are important soft skills for managing crews and collaborating with stakeholders. These abilities ensure projects are completed safely, on time, and to quality standards while maintaining team morale.

The main difference between a Construction Foreman and a Construction Supervisor lies in their scope of responsibilities. A Construction Foreman primarily oversees daily on-site activities and direct labor crews, while a Construction Supervisor has a broader role, managing multiple projects and coordinating between different teams. Both roles require similar certifications and work in similar environments, but the Supervisor typically has more managerial duties and strategic oversight.
